98//////////////////
99G4Track & G4Track::operator=(const G4Track &right)
100//////////////////
101{
102  if (this != &right) {
103   fPosition = right.fPosition;
104   fGlobalTime = right.fGlobalTime;
105   fLocalTime = right.fLocalTime;
106   fTrackLength = right.fTrackLength;
107   fWeight = right.fWeight;
108   fStepLength = right.fStepLength;
109
110   // Track ID (and Parent ID) is not copied and set to zero for new track
111   fTrackID = 0;
112   fParentID =0;
113
114   // CurrentStepNumber is set to be 0
115   fCurrentStepNumber = 0;
116
117   // dynamic particle information
118   fpDynamicParticle = new G4DynamicParticle(*(right.fpDynamicParticle));
119 
120   // track status and flags for tracking 
121   fTrackStatus = right.fTrackStatus;
122   fBelowThreshold = right.fBelowThreshold;
123   fGoodForTracking = right.fGoodForTracking;
124   
125   // Step information (Step Length, Step Number, pointer to the Step,)
126   // are not copied
127   fpStep=0;
128
129   // vertex information
130   fVtxPosition = right.fVtxPosition;
131   fpLVAtVertex = right.fpLVAtVertex;
132   fVtxKineticEnergy = right.fVtxKineticEnergy;
133   fVtxMomentumDirection = right.fVtxMomentumDirection;
134
135   // CreatorProcess and UserInformation are not copied
136   fpCreatorProcess = 0;
137   fpUserInformation = 0;
138  }
139  return *this;
140}

149#include "G4ParticleTable.hh"
150///////////////////
151G4double G4Track::GetVelocity() const
152///////////////////
153{ 
154  static G4bool isFirstTime = true;
155  static G4ParticleDefinition* fOpticalPhoton =0;
156 
157  static G4Material*               prev_mat =0;
158  static G4MaterialPropertyVector* groupvel =0;
159  static G4double                  prev_velocity =0;
160  static G4double                  prev_momentum =0;
161 
162
163  if ( isFirstTime ) {
164    isFirstTime = false;
165    // set  fOpticalPhoton
166    fOpticalPhoton = G4ParticleTable::GetParticleTable()->FindParticle("opticalphoton");
167  }
168
169  G4double velocity ;
170 
171  G4double mass = fpDynamicParticle->GetMass();
172
173  velocity = c_light ; 
174
175  // special case for photons
176  if (  (fOpticalPhoton !=0)  &&
177        (fpDynamicParticle->GetDefinition()==fOpticalPhoton) ){
178
179    G4Material* mat=0; 
180    G4bool update_groupvel = false;
181    if ( this->GetStep() ){
182      mat= this->GetMaterial();         //   Fix for repeated volumes
183    }else{
184      if (fpTouchable!=0){ 
185        mat=fpTouchable->GetVolume()->GetLogicalVolume()->GetMaterial();
186      }
187    }
188    // check if previous step is in the same volume
189    //  and get new GROUPVELOVITY table if necessary
190    if ((mat != prev_mat)||(groupvel==0)) {
191        groupvel = 0;
192        if(mat->GetMaterialPropertiesTable() != 0)
193          groupvel = mat->GetMaterialPropertiesTable()->GetProperty("GROUPVEL");
194        update_groupvel = true;
195    }
196    prev_mat = mat;
197     
198    if  (groupvel != 0 ) {
199        // light velocity = c/(rindex+d(rindex)/d(log(E_phot)))
200        // values stored in GROUPVEL material properties vector
201        velocity =  prev_velocity;
202         
203        // check if momentum is same as in the previous step
204        //  and calculate group velocity if necessary
205        if( update_groupvel || (fpDynamicParticle->GetTotalMomentum() != prev_momentum) ) {
206          velocity =
207            groupvel->GetProperty(fpDynamicParticle->GetTotalMomentum());
208           prev_velocity = velocity;
209          prev_momentum = fpDynamicParticle->GetTotalMomentum();
210        }
211    }
212
213  } else {
214    if (mass<DBL_MIN) {
215      velocity = c_light;
216    } else {
217      G4double T = fpDynamicParticle->GetKineticEnergy();
218      velocity = c_light*std::sqrt(T*(T+2.*mass))/(T+mass);
219    }
220  }
221                                                                               
222  return velocity ;
223}
